The Baddest (Davido album) : ウィキペディア英語版 | The Baddest (Davido album) }} ''The Baddest'', stylized as ''O.B.O The Baddest'', is an upcoming studio album by Nigerian afropop singer and songwriter Davido. It is the singer's second overall album and the follow up to his debut LP, ''Omo Baba Olowo'' (2012). The album, which was originally scheduled to be released on 8 June 2015, was later postponed to 2016. Preceding the album's release were the singles "Gobe", "Skelewu", "Aye and "Tchelete" which were enlisted as bonus tracks. As the executive producer of the album, Davido collaborated with other producers like Shizzi, J Fem, Uhuru, Kid Dominant, Young Jonn, Del B, Puffy Tee and P2J. The album, which was preceded by the release of three singles, features guest appearances from Meek Mill, Don Jazzy, Runtown, Timaya, Trey Songz, Wale, P-Square and Akon. ==Promotion== To promote the album, Davido released several singles and went on to launch his clothing line and headlined several concerts. On 30 April 2015, he released "Tchelete" which features vocals from South African duo Mafikizolo; he also went on to release promotional tracks like "Owo Ni Koko" and "The Sound". On 30 May 2015, Davido took to Twitter to announce that the album launch and concert will hold in the U.K on 25 September 2015.
